- Obtains appropriate patient medical history necessary to perform diagnostic procedures as ordered: radiology, laboratory, audiometry (if applicable), and spirometry.
- Performs proper patient/specimen identification. Obtains and labels specimens appropriately and completely according to policy.
- Performs patient intake of information, documents patient care, and data collection appropriately in patient records.
- Assist physician/provider with patient exams, including but not limited to patient positioning, collection of specimens, performance of non-invasive procedures, and general patient support.
- Performs invasive procedures under the direct supervision of the clinic physician/provider.
- Obtains blood specimens in a timely manner by venous puncture on patients of all ages without undue stress or injury to the patient while adhering to universal precautions procedures.
- Retrieves test results and clinical documents.
- Populates lab results into appropriate flow sheets accurately and in a timely fashion.
- Maintains quality and safety compliance of the lab equipment.
- Verifies accurate handling of all lab samples couriered from the clinic.
- Ensures superior ongoing patient satisfaction and customer service.
- Communicates effectively with internal and external customers.
- Maintains professional standards related to clinical practices, and continuing education.
- Maintains a safe and clean environment.
- Practices fiscal responsibility and accountability.
- Maintains adequate stock of supplies by monitoring par levels.
- Assists with scheduling, reception and computer work as needed.
